public class ScriptableFilter extends AbstractScriptableHeapObject<Response> implements Filter
A scriptable filter. This filter acts as a simple wrapper around the scripting engine. Scripts are provided with the bindings provided byAbstractScriptableHeapObjectplus :context- the associated request contextrequest- the HTTP requestnext- the next handler in the filter chain.
Contains also easy access to
attributesfrom theAttributesContext, e.g:attributes.user = "jackson", instead ofcontexts.attributes.attributes.user = "jackson".In the same way, it gives access to
sessionfrom theSessionContext, for example, you can use:session.put(...), instead ofcontexts.session.session.put(...).Like Java based filters, scripts are free to choose whether or not they forward the request to the next handler or, instead, return a response immediately.

Method Detail
-
filter
public Promise<Response,NeverThrowsException> filter(Context context, Request request, Handler next)
Description copied from interface:FilterFilters the request and/or response of an exchange. To pass the request to the next filter or handler in the chain, the filter callsnext.handle(context, request).This method may elect not to pass the request to the next filter or handler, and instead handle the request itself. It can achieve this by merely avoiding a call to
next.handle(context, request)and creating its own response object. The filter is also at liberty to replace a response with another of its own by intercepting the response returned by the next handler.
